Jean Cocteau (1889-1963) referred to himself as a poet and, indeed, he was. But he was also a prolific artist, novelist, playwright and film director. He was one of the most avant-garde artists of the twentieth century, highly influential in the Dadaist and Surrealist movements, among others.

This wonderful book explores his life and illustrates the diversity of his work through 194 illustrations, most of which are im full color. It also puts him in context with other leading modern artists such as Picasso and Modigliani. It is an absolutely stimulating visual treasure.
